Learning equals behavior change

The main insight from this podcast episode is that learning is not simply acquiring knowledge or concepts, but it is actually behavior change. The speaker emphasizes that true learning only takes place when our behavior is altered. It is highlighted that activities like reading, attending lectures, or memorizing facts do not constitute learning. Instead, learning should result in tangible changes in our actions, thoughts, and beliefs. The speaker encourages listeners to be specific about how their behavior will change as a result of learning.
